It is normal to wonder whether you're producing enough, and also to wonder if the baby's hunger is endless during growth spurts. The body's process of deciding to produce more milk and produce it at certain times of day is based upon getting a lot of extra demand for a couple of days. The technique, persistence and mouth shape of the baby matter a lot, and with some babies, a pump is a must.įrustration is totally normal for moms of all size and levels of production ability. It can also vary a lot for the same mother with different babies. Hydration, relaxation, practice, b vitamins and overall health tend to count for much more in terms of overall production than size. Many women with D+ need lactation support, or to partially or completely bottle feed. Many women with A and B cups are able to provide a lot of milk. The fat layer on top that's really visible isn't doing the work of the milk production.
